Democracy for All - Restoring Immigrant Voting Rights in the U.S. - Hardback - 2006
Ronald Hayduk
Resumo
Examining the politics of voting in the United States, this book shows how voting rights can empower minority groups. It presents arguments for and against noncitizen voting rights, and also examines contemporary political organisations and actors, who fought for and against campaigns to reinstate noncitizen voting.
